How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Rivers End?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rivers End Studio Apartments | $995 | $995 | $995 |
| Rivers End 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,410 | $952 | $2,745 |
Rivers End 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,522 | $1,040 | $2,279 |
| Rivers End 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,676 | $1,160 | $2,501 |
| Rivers End 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,659 | $1,489 | $2,150 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Rivers End Apartments
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Rivers End?
The cheapest apartment in Rivers End is Live Oaks Apartments which is listed at $1,154, while the average apartment in Rivers End costs $1,626.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Rivers End?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 19 regular apartments in Rivers End that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
How do the prices of cheap apartments compare to the average apartment in Rivers End?
Cheap apartments in Rivers End have an average cost of $692 which is $934 cheaper than the average rent for all rentals in Rivers End.
